Transaction 0740458a10379cc8a486d99af018dedbe7c51290f1d73ed03f355f9151c75c4e
1 Input
1 Output
-
0740458a10379cc8a486d99af018dedbe7c51290f1d73ed03f355f9151c75c4e:0
- value
- 531291
- script pubkey
- OP_0 OP_PUSHBYTES_20 e247c06af1285520a8c0e289302eac96ea12faea
- address
- bc1qufruq6h39p2jp2xqu2ynqt4vjm4p97h2gqwjdc